Bevelled closer: in this break, the stretcher face is bevelled in such a way that at one end half-width and on another end, full width is maintained. BEVELED CLOSER: A kind of a closer in which the total length of a brick is chamfered in such a manner that the half-width is maintained at one end and full length on the other face end. The general arrangement of bricks in this type of bonding is similar to that of English bond except that the heading courses are only inserted at every fourth or sixth course. Three-quarter bat A three-quarter-bat is the one having its length equal to three-quarters of the length of a full brick. KING CLOSER: King closer is a closer bigger than a half brick, more specifically a brick with one corner cut away making the header at that end half the width of a brick. The actual dimensions of the brick are within certain tolerances of the specified size tolerances are spelled out in ASTM C216,Standard Specification for Facing Brickand ASTM C652,Standard Specification for Hollow Brick. There are three factors that help determine brick durability: compressive strength, water absorption, and the saturation coefficient. This type of bond is not so strong as English bond and its use is restricted to the construction of dwarf walls or other similar types of walls which are not subjected to large stresses. Manufacturers produce bricks to their own specifications (the same manufacturer may even produce different sizes across plants), so it is important to confirm sizes; however, the sizes in the tables below come from the Brick Industry Association and are the most commonly produced sizes. There are three different ways of discussing sizes when it comes to brick and it is important to understand the different sizes so there isn't any confusion - we will start by discussing the different dimensions: specified, actual, and nominal. When discussing brick sizing, three kinds of dimensions may be referenced: Modular bricks are sized so that their nominal dimensions are round numbers or will add up to round numbers when bricks are grouped. Most bricks are manufactured so that the nominal sizes fit into a grid of 4", which coincides with the modules of other building materials such as doors, windows, and wood components.
